The restoration market serving Coalton, Ohio, is characterized by a reliance on regional providers from larger nearby hubs like Jackson and Chillicothe. As a small village, Coalton does not host its own major restoration companies. The market is moderately competitive, with a few key regional players dominating the service area. The average quality of service is high, as these companies must maintain strong reputations and certifications (like IICRC) to work effectively with insurance providers across a wide rural area. Typical pricing is in line with national averages, but can be influenced by travel time for emergency calls to more remote locations like Coalton. Most providers offer free estimates and have extensive experience in navigating the insurance claim process, which is a critical service for homeowners in the region following common issues like basement flooding, storm damage, and fire.

In Coalton, common causes include basement flooding from heavy spring rains and snowmelt, burst pipes due to our cold Ohio winters, and appliance failures. You should respond within 24-48 hours to prevent mold growth, which thrives in our humid Midwest climate and can cause secondary damage and health concerns.
Always verify the company is licensed and insured in Ohio. Look for IICRC-certified technicians, which is the industry standard. For local trust, ask for references from recent jobs in Coalton or nearby communities like Wellston or Oak Hill, and check their standing with the Better Business Bureau.
Generally, labor and service call rates in Coalton and rural Jackson County can be slightly lower than in metros like Columbus. However, material costs are similar, and the total project cost is primarily driven by the extent of damage. Always get a detailed, written estimate that breaks down labor, materials, and any potential Ohio sales tax.
Ohio's seasonal extremes impact restoration timelines. Winter repairs may be delayed by snow and ice, requiring temporary weatherproofing. Spring and summer are peak seasons for severe thunderstorms and tornadoes in the region, potentially leading to longer wait times for contractors due to high demand after widespread storm events.
